Are you interested in supporting students in Central Queensland Region? Applications are currently being sought for Guidance Officer positions for the CQR pool for the 2026 year. You will have the opportunity to provide professional expertise, leadership and support to school communities and networks in the development and implementation of plans, programs, and procedures to assist students in achieving positive educational, developmental and lifelong learning outcomes. Guidance officers are specialist teachers who deliver a broad range of services to school community members. They contribute to the development of a comprehensive student support and wellbeing program that is responsive to the needs of the school community.
Qualifications
* High level of teaching ability
* Exemplary communication skills
* Advanced individual and group counselling skills
* Flexibility and adaptability
Responsibilities
* Advocate, provide counselling, psychoeducational assessment and individual student support, recommendations and advice to students, teachers and parents concerning educational, behavioural, career development, mental health and family issues.
* Work as part of a multidisciplinary team and facilitate effective working relationships and partnerships with parents, school personnel and external support agencies in order to provide a comprehensive support, case management and referral service that optimises students' access and engagement in educational programs.
* Provide a counselling and referral service to assist students in decision making about critical educational, personal, social, emotional and career development, and provide ongoing support during the implementation phase of their decision.
Benefits
* Teacher housing
* RoRRS incentives
* Additional week's holiday per annum
